Plastinated fetus: 3D CT scan (VRT) evaluation.

ABSTRACT
Objective:
The intent of this study was to evaluate the effect of plastination on the morphology and structure of stored organs, to find out how much accuracy a plastinated specimen has, and to look into the changes that occurred because of plastination. Materials andMethods:
A human fetus of gestational age 24 weeks was plastinated, and 3D CT scan evaluation of the fetus was done.Results:
The results showed normal, well-defined, clearly identifiable organs, with no alteration in morphology and structure of organs.Conclusion:
In our opinion, plastinated specimens are better way of visualization of morphology and structure of stored organs, which is a useful tool for teaching as well as for research purposes.
